Our Blue Lake Stringless Pole Green Beans seeds will soon produce fleshy, tender pods that grow to be roughly 5.5 inches in length.

These stringless pole beans have mild flavoring and are high in vitamins A, B, and C.

Blue Lake beans make for excellent snap beans. They are also often dried on the vines for clear white shell beans.

Growing Blue Lake Stringless Pole Beans is easy! Sow seeds outdoors in an area that sees full sun after all danger of frost has passed. When planting, space Blue Lake Pole Beans around two seeds per every 4 inches, separating each row of seeds by about 20 inches.

Instructions Chevron Down Chevron Forward

Sow seeds when the soil is warm and all danger of frost is past. Plant 2 seeds every 4 inches. Soaking seeds overnight before planting will speed germination. Thin to 1 plant every 4 inches when the plants have 4 leaves. Pick early and often to encourage production. Sow every 2 weeks until 8 weeks before fall frost.

Planting Depth: 1 - 1.5"

Seed Spacing: Sow Blue Lake Stringless Beans seeds roughly 4" apart in rows keeping rows approximately 20" apart.

Suggestions Chevron Down Chevron Forward

Avoid working around beans when wet; this may spread diseases. When weeding, hoe gently because beans are shallow-rooted. Mulch plants only after thinning.
